問題タブ [rubyxl]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
298 参照

ruby-on-rails - RailsでRubyXLワークブックをバイナリに変換する方法

gem RubyXL を使用してワークブックに何かをエクスポートしましたが、ファイルの作成には使用したくありませんworkbook.write()が、ワークブックを mysql DB にバイナリとして保存したいと考えています。

RubyXL ワークブックバイナリに変換するにはどうすればよいですか?

0 投票する
3 に答える
6525 参照

ruby-on-rails - http://rubygems.org/ からデータをダウンロードできません

ROR で ruby​​ を使用して xlsx Excel ファイルをエクスポートしたいので、rubyXL をインストールします。私はこのコマンドを使用します: sudo gem install ruby​​XL --source http://rubygems.orgそして、以下のようなエラーが発生します

私を助けてください

0 投票する
0 に答える
697 参照

ruby - 各セルに色を塗りつぶす方法

Roo と RubyXL を使用して Excel スプレッドシートを変更しています。

Excel シートで色を塗りつぶすコードをコメント アウトすると、エラーは発生しません。

私の完全なコード:

しかし、Nil[] Nil クラス エラーが発生します。

0 投票する
1 に答える
165 参照

ruby - 変数 i に割り当てて、オブジェクトの値をインクリメントしようとしています。ご意見をお聞かせください

以下は私のコードです。Excelシートからページのテキストボックスに値を入力しようとしています。例: テキスト ボックスの ID が 'allocationRegContrib[17].newFundValue' の場合、20 という値を入力します。同様に、ID が 'allocationRegContrib[18].newFundValue' の別のテキスト ボックスについても、40 という値を入力します。達成する方法。同様に、IDは60まで続きます。しかし、すべてのテキストボックスに入力したくありません。そこで、fill_in "allocationRegContrib[i].newFundValue" のように使用しようとしています。

しかし、それは私にはうまくいきません。エラーは「カピバラ要素のallocationRegContrib[i].newFundValueが見つかりません」です。ご意見をお聞かせください

0 投票する
0 に答える
80 参照

ruby - ruby/cucumber スクリプトの実行時間を短縮する方法

基本的に以下は私のコードです.Excelシートのすべての要素がWebページに存在するかどうかを確認しようとしています(データはWebページに表形式で表示されます)。そこにない場合、セルは赤、そうでない場合は緑になります。Excelシートのすべてのデータに対してテーブル内のすべての値を読み取ろうとするため、このコードの実行には時間がかかります。10 行と 10 列あり、実行に 2 時間以上かかる

0 投票する
0 に答える
152 参照

ruby - rubyXL を使用して ruby​​ スクリプトを書き込んでいるときに、Excel ファイルに変更が表示されない

これは、最初の行を強調表示している私の ruby​​ スクリプトです。問題は、ファイルが既に開かれているときに行が強調表示されないことです。しかし、ファイルを閉じて再度開くと、変更が反映されています。ファイルが既に開かれているときにリアルタイムで変更を行うための回避策はありますか。